Hydroxyethylcellulose for Sale A Versatile and Essential Polymer


Hydroxyethylcellulose (HEC) is a cellulose derivative that has gained prominence in various industries due to its unique rheological properties and versatility. This water-soluble polymer is derived from natural cellulose, making it an eco-friendly choice in many applications. As the demand for sustainable and effective materials grows, HEC has emerged as a critical component in several sectors including cosmetics, pharmaceuticals, construction, and food processing.


What is Hydroxyethylcellulose?


HEC is a white to off-white powdered material that dissolves in hot or cold water to form a clear and viscous solution. Its structure is characterized by the addition of hydroxyethyl groups to the cellulose backbone, which enhances its solubility and thickening capabilities. This modification maintains the biocompatibility of cellulose while allowing for increased functionality.


Applications of Hydroxyethylcellulose


1. Cosmetics and Personal Care Products One of the most significant applications of HEC is in cosmetics. It serves as a thickening agent, helping to stabilize emulsions and improve the texture of creams and lotions. HEC is widely used in skincare products, shampoos, and conditioners due to its ability to enhance the feel and application of formulations, while also improving water retention in hair and skin.


2. Pharmaceuticals In the pharmaceutical industry, HEC is utilized as a binder in tablet formulations and as a coating agent to control the release of active ingredients. Its non-toxic and biodegradable nature makes it an ideal choice for both oral and topical preparations. Additionally, HEC can be found in various gels and ointments, ensuring that medications are effectively delivered to the affected areas.


3. Construction The construction sector has embraced HEC for its performance-enhancing properties in cement, plaster, and tile adhesives. By improving workability and water retention, HEC ensures that construction materials maintain their strength while also being easier to apply. Its use can lead to improved adhesion and reduced crack formation, which is critical in building durable structures.

4. Food Processing HEC is employed in the food industry as a thickening and stabilizing agent. It can improve the texture of sauces, dressings, and dairy products while also contributing to the overall mouthfeel. HEC is considered safe for consumption and is used in various food applications to enhance product quality.
